That might be a genuine eGo battery. They usually run about 3.4V, but I've seen some newer ones advertised at 3.7V. I've been using the EMDCC at 1.7 ohms, which makes it low resistance. The resistance is determined by the ohms of the atomizer or cartomizer. I think anything below 2.3 ohms is considered low resistance. You could use anything between 1.7 ohms and 3.0 ohms on that battery and be safe, although the low resistance stuff will run the battery down sooner, and possibly shorten it's life.

As bruiser said, you can safely run any LR (low resistance) atomizer or cartomizer on that battery. The most common "sweet spot" for eGo users is 1.7-2.0 ohms, specifically the Smoktech 1.7 ohm resurrector cartomizers and the Boge 2.0 ohm cartomizers. For atomizers, any LR 510 atomizer (about 2 ohm) would be a good place to start.

Even though many people have reported leaking with clearomizers, it looks like your supplier has chosen to carry very good basic equipment.
